Carver Yachts 570 Voyager: BoatTEST Review

Reviewed by Jeff Hammond

Overview

Carver Yachts has established a strong reputation for crafting luxurious, comfortable, and thoughtfully designed vessels, with the 570 Voyager standing out as their flagship model. This pilot house design cockpit motor yacht exemplifies refined craftsmanship combined with a functional layout, delivering an elegant cruising experience. Its spacious 15-foot, 4-inch beam allows for open and relaxed living spaces, making it an exceptional choice for extended voyages.

Interior Living Spaces

The salon benefits from the generous beam, featuring two barrel seats or a loveseat to port and an L-shaped ultra-leather lounge to starboard, creating a welcoming and comfortable environment. The U-shaped galley is fully equipped with conveniences akin to a full-size kitchen, including a side-by-side refrigerator freezer beneath the counter, a two-burner stove, convection microwave oven, optional coffee maker, and a double sink set into a solid surface countertop. Just forward and elevated by two steps is the pilot house, which offers seating for five on an ultra-leather couch to port alongside a captain's chair designed for comfort and command. The pilot house is thoughtfully arranged so that all navigational information is easily accessible, even in challenging weather conditions.

Private Accommodations

The master stateroom, located aft, spans the full beam of the yacht and features an island pedestal bed accented with lacquered cherry trim and elegant appointments. It includes a luxurious vanity with mirror, stereo, and television system. The ensuite master head offers a spacious bathtub and shower combination. Forward lies the VIP guest stateroom, also with an island pedestal bed, cedar-lined closets, television, and private access to a guest head equipped with a vanity and shower stall. A third stateroom to port is ideal for children, featuring over-and-under bunks. A beautifully curved companionway with rich cherry walls connects these spaces, a design element typically reserved for much larger mega yachts.

Exterior Design and Flybridge

Access to the flybridge is provided via a stairway through a weatherproof hatch. The flybridge itself is a spacious social area with seating for ten in an aft lounge accompanied by a removable table. A full wet bar with sink and storage enhances the entertainment capabilities, with an optional Gen Air grill available. The dual helm seat rotates forward, complementing the single helm chair at the command center, which offers full instrumentation and excellent visibility for the captain.

Power and Performance

The 570 Voyager is powered by twin Volvo D12 electronically controlled diesel engines, each producing 675 horsepower. These engines are specifically designed for faster planing boats and incorporate Volvo's electronic diesel control system, which optimizes ignition timing for improved fuel efficiency, increased power, and reduced emissions. Key features include six electronic unit injectors, a gear-driven fuel pump, fresh water-cooled turbocharger and air cooler, and precise electronic engine controls. The D12 engines deliver maximum torque at just 1400 RPM, facilitating quick acceleration for a vessel of this size. Performance testing revealed a cruising speed of 26.8 miles per hour and a top speed of 32.6 miles per hour, with a quiet operation measured at 78 decibels. With an overall length of 59 feet 2 inches, a draft of 4 feet 9 inches, and a fully loaded weight of 52,500 pounds, the yacht offers an impressive range of 352 miles on a single fuel fill.

Conclusion

The Carver 570 Voyager combines elegance, comfort, and advanced engineering to provide a luxurious cruising yacht that does not compromise on performance or style. Its spacious interiors, well-appointed accommodations, and powerful yet efficient propulsion system make it well suited for extended cruising adventures. This vessel exemplifies the best of Carver Yachts' design philosophy, offering owners a refined and capable platform for exploring the waterways in comfort and sophistication.

The Biggest Pros and Cons

The 2002 Carver Yachts 570 Voyager offers a range of features that appeal to cruisers looking for spacious accommodations and reliable performance. Here are some of the pros and cons of this model:

Pros

Spacious Interior: The 570 Voyager is known for its roomy layout, including multiple staterooms and ample living space, making it ideal for extended trips or entertaining guests.

Comfort and Amenities: Equipped with a full galley, comfortable salon, and well-appointed cabins, it offers a home-like experience on the water.

Flybridge Design: The elevated flybridge provides excellent visibility for navigation and a great spot for socializing.

Solid Construction: Built with quality materials and craftsmanship typical of Carver Yachts, ensuring durability and reliability.

Good Performance: Powered by twin engines, it delivers steady cruising speeds suitable for coastal and offshore voyages.

Cons

Fuel Consumption: As a larger motor yacht, it tends to have higher fuel consumption compared to smaller vessels, which can impact operating costs.

Maintenance Costs: The size and complexity of the boat may result in higher maintenance and upkeep expenses.

Aging Electronics: Being a 2002 model, some onboard systems and electronics may be outdated and could require upgrades.

Maneuverability: Due to its size, it may be less agile in tight docking situations compared to smaller boats.
